Given Input numbers are 923, 318, 477, 132
To find the GCD of numbers using factoring list out all the divisors of each number
Divisors of 923
List of positive integer divisors of 923 that divides 923 without a remainder.
1, 13, 71, 923
Divisors of 318
List of positive integer divisors of 318 that divides 318 without a remainder.
1, 2, 3, 6, 53, 106, 159, 318
Divisors of 477
List of positive integer divisors of 477 that divides 477 without a remainder.
1, 3, 9, 53, 159, 477
Divisors of 132
List of positive integer divisors of 132 that divides 132 without a remainder.
1, 2, 3, 4, 6, 11, 12, 22, 33, 44, 66, 132
Greatest Common Divisior
We found the divisors of 923, 318, 477, 132 . The biggest common divisior number is the GCD number.
So the Greatest Common Divisior 923, 318, 477, 132 is 1.
Therefore, GCD of numbers 923, 318, 477, 132 is 1
Given Input Data is 923, 318, 477, 132
Make a list of Prime Factors of all the given numbers initially
Prime Factorization of 923 is 13 x 71
Prime Factorization of 318 is 2 x 3 x 53
Prime Factorization of 477 is 3 x 3 x 53
Prime Factorization of 132 is 2 x 2 x 3 x 11
The above numbers do not have any common prime factor. So GCD is 1
